Hollywood Records has released cover version of The Cure’s Pictures of You featured in the seventh episode of the Hulu original series Little Fires Everywhere. The song (co-written by Boris Williams, Simon Gallup, Roger O’Donnell, Robert Smith, Porl Thompson and Lol Tolhurst) is performed by Lauren Ruth Ward and produced by the show’s composers Mark Isham & Isabella Summers. Def Jam Recordings has released the original song I Choose from the Netflix animated film The Willoughbys. The track is performed by Alessia Cara, produced by Jon Levine and co-written by Cara herself, the film’s composer Mark Mothersbaugh, director Kris Pearn, Jordyn Kane, Jason Rabinowitz, Mark Mothersbaugh, Brayden Deskins, Colton Fisher and Diana Studenberg.
